    Best fabric cement ever.

    Bish's Tear Mender is a rubber cement that will glue anything where it can penetrate the fibers. I'm rough on work clothes. I tear them up all the time. I use it to mend blue jeans, shirts, jackets, gloves and boots. It dries clear and will stand up to repeated machine washing's. HOWEVER, the area glued will turn black when exposed to the heat of a clothes dryer. Even at that though, the bond still holds. It is recommended that the area to be glued be clean and free of grease etc., and that's probably good advise, but I have glued gloves that were very dirty, greasy, and wet, and the bond still held. The glue tends to bead on the surface, so watch for run off, but it's easy to spread with your finger(s), and when you're done the dried glue on your finger(s) just rubs right off. And ...

  • Doesn't work at all!!!

    Beware this glue doesn't looks and works like the advertising videos. Has a consistency and looks like milk. Very liquid like water. It does stain when it dries. Soaks the fabrics. Dries after more than half an hour. School glue will do better for fabric than this. I read other reviews about how good is and got it and boom, it doesn't do anything. It seems that this glue loses its wonders after a certain short period of time. The bottle says it has a life of 12 months after purchasing but doesn't state date of manufacture. I had to buy fabric tac. I totally regret buying tear mender. Tear mender will not work if its old. DO NOT BUY THIS PRODUCT!!! I don't recommend it!!! This product seems to have a very short life comparing to other fabric glues.
